Murder Story Q&A

Who wrote Murder Story's ?

Murder Story was written by Jim Kerr & Charlie Burchill.

Who produced Murder Story's ?

Murder Story was produced by John Leckie.

When did Simple Minds release Murder Story?

Simple Minds released Murder Story on Sun Mar 25 1979.
